)]}'
{
  "commit": "6f59db12a64f4496866952a251122ccb77a36c6b",
  "tree": "29fcb69aa1f491974ec2b2ea5a01155b53940be5",
  "parents": [
    "23700debf767ef7fdfc30d96612771c3a03ad40d"
  ],
  "author": {
    "name": "Eric Laurent",
    "email": "elaurent@google.com",
    "time": "Fri Jul 26 17:16:50 2013 -0700"
  },
  "committer": {
    "name": "Eric Laurent",
    "email": "elaurent@google.com",
    "time": "Fri Nov 22 09:09:51 2013 -0800"
  },
  "message": "update offloaded audio track sampling rate\n\nAudioPlayer must read the sampling rate from offloaded audio sinks\nwhenever a new time position is computed as the decoder can update\nthe sampling rate on the fly.\n\nChange-Id: I997e5248cfd4017aeceb4e11689324ded2a5bc88\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"bec77ce52c1c67d466cc31115daa31366107efbf",
      "old_mode": 33188,
      "old_path": "include/media/AudioTrack.h",
      "new_id": "e163f88e244fa9ad0b2bc2637777d917b1f46a5b",
      "new_mode": 33188,
      "new_path": "include/media/AudioTrack.h"
    },
    {
      "type": "modify",
      "old_id": "cc244f00feaa59b76944b99c57c3d6fedc56cf64",
      "old_mode": 33188,
      "old_path": "include/media/MediaPlayerInterface.h",
      "new_id": "26d8729658836ad4c20ea94c2a918df4820ae74a",
      "new_mode": 33188,
      "new_path": "include/media/MediaPlayerInterface.h"
    },
    {
      "type": "modify",
      "old_id": "912a43cbed61ad16103a07b626ce7d526722624b",
      "old_mode": 33188,
      "old_path": "include/media/stagefright/AudioPlayer.h",
      "new_id": "14afb851bc32dabb8505eae982f611354452f9f1",
      "new_mode": 33188,
      "new_path": "include/media/stagefright/AudioPlayer.h"
    },
    {
      "type": "modify",
      "old_id": "5aeba4fc3298ef77948c77c51f01fcb44c9d87a2",
      "old_mode": 33261,
      "old_path": "libvideoeditor/lvpp/VideoEditorPlayer.cpp",
      "new_id": "8d656c4726f4bf90eada472afa9b2565c33b3b06",
      "new_mode": 33261,
      "new_path": "libvideoeditor/lvpp/VideoEditorPlayer.cpp"
    },
    {
      "type": "modify",
      "old_id": "5862c0851d3963cbb5d204c922329f0f4fb96331",
      "old_mode": 33261,
      "old_path": "libvideoeditor/lvpp/VideoEditorPlayer.h",
      "new_id": "b8c1254ab6f6e06f4752fcbe0f82a28c1f724e14",
      "new_mode": 33261,
      "new_path": "libvideoeditor/lvpp/VideoEditorPlayer.h"
    },
    {
      "type": "modify",
      "old_id": "8319dcd0ae78ff9181dc441bbc9e56d9d6d38eff",
      "old_mode": 33188,
      "old_path": "media/libmedia/AudioTrack.cpp",
      "new_id": "4b937147814dbeb2cb57786402ff49abc9007ad6",
      "new_mode": 33188,
      "new_path": "media/libmedia/AudioTrack.cpp"
    },
    {
      "type": "modify",
      "old_id": "cd052e6b323e3ded0fedda807e7683ac1a24d838",
      "old_mode": 33188,
      "old_path": "media/libmediaplayerservice/MediaPlayerService.cpp",
      "new_id": "9ac91056f89d1c43d8e27858c6d45576625c213d",
      "new_mode": 33188,
      "new_path": "media/libmediaplayerservice/MediaPlayerService.cpp"
    },
    {
      "type": "modify",
      "old_id": "a486cb5f027e3ffb0258d83abba12dee379fc3be",
      "old_mode": 33188,
      "old_path": "media/libmediaplayerservice/MediaPlayerService.h",
      "new_id": "9c084e19eeec3ead23cfdfff97943479667d08c1",
      "new_mode": 33188,
      "new_path": "media/libmediaplayerservice/MediaPlayerService.h"
    },
    {
      "type": "modify",
      "old_id": "a8a87864a2857c346b0ce0403cfde6270ea4ba61",
      "old_mode": 33188,
      "old_path": "media/libstagefright/AudioPlayer.cpp",
      "new_id": "05ee34eb1eb4c91f55b06da3adea74e38d7cef6a",
      "new_mode": 33188,
      "new_path": "media/libstagefright/AudioPlayer.cpp"
    }
  ]
}
